.kid or .kids is the real solution, but is something that is politically not acceptable to either side: it would be admitting that the internet is an "adult place", and that kids shouldn't be allowed to roam freely.

The politicos expect it to be like prime time TV, the occasional fart joke and the Friends girls with hard nipples, but not much else. They can't for the life of them imagine that they cannot control the net in that manner.

.kids would be like building a playground in the middle of the city, giving the children a safe place to surf. It would be VERY easy to make browsers kid safe, allowing them to only go to sites that reverse to .kids, and there could easily be a system of performance bonds or other used to assure that .kids domains are used only for child safe stuff. Charge a higher than average fee for the domain, and use that money to police the content and dis-active any site that isn't within the agreed parameters for a kid safe site.

disney.kids - google.kids (only kids domains!) - yahoo.kids ... the potential is there, and it would be EASY to set up...

not going to happen... some moron killed this idea already trying to do blahblah.kids.us - it went nowhere.
